成熟【せいじゅく】
maturity, ripeness
未熟【みじゅく】
unripe, green, inexperienced, immature, unskilled
熟知【じゅくち】
being familiar with, having a thorough knowledge of, being well-informed about
熟練【じゅくれん】
skill, dexterity, proficiency
未熟児【みじゅくじ】
premature baby
熟成【じゅくせい】
maturing, ripening, aging, ageing, curing, fermenting
熟語【じゅくご】
kanji compound, idiom, idiomatic phrase
円熟【えんじゅく】
ripeness, mellowness, maturity
熟慮【じゅくりょ】
deliberation, (thoughtful) consideration, to consider a matter carefully
習熟【しゅうじゅく】
proficiency, mastery, becoming proficient (in)
熟す【こなす】
to digest, to break down, to break to pieces, to crush, to be able to use, to be good at, to have a good command of, to finish, to complete, to manage, to perform, to sell, to do ... well, to do ... completely
熟し【こなし】
carriage, movement (of the body)
完熟【かんじゅく】
full ripeness, full maturity
熟睡【じゅくすい】
deep sleep, sound sleep, profound sleep
早熟【そうじゅく】
precocity, early ripening, premature development
半熟【はんじゅく】
half-cooked, half-done, soft-boiled, half-ripe, unripe
熟読【じゅくどく】
careful reading, reading thoroughly, perusal
